Why do this
problem?
This is a tough
problem for learners who relish the challenge of working with
large and difficult numbers. It would become more accessible if
calculators were used.
Key questions
Have you found out how cubes are needed to cover the single
cube?
Have you remembered that there is only "up to $1000$ of each
colour"?
What is the cube root of $1000$?
Have you made list of the cubes up to $1000$?
Possible support
Suggest making starting by finding how many cubes are needed to
cover one (yellow) cube. This can be done practically with
interlocking cubes.
